GENERAL ASSEMBLY OF NORTH CAROLINA

1983 SESSION

 

 

CHAPTER 365

HOUSE BILL 854

 

AN ACT TO WAIVE COMPLIANCE WITH CERTAIN STATUTES IN THE CONSTRUCTION OF THE NEW HANOVER COUNTY REFUSE FIRED STEAM GENERATING FACILITY.

 

The General Assembly of North Carolina enacts:

 

Section 1.  The New Hanover County Board of County Commissioners is authorized to enter into contracts to construct a refuse fired steam generating facility with electrical co- generation capabilities for New Hanover County, notwithstanding the provisions of Article 8 of Chapter 143, Chapter 153A, Chapter 133, Chapter 89C, and Chapter 87 of the General Statutes.  All acts heretofore taken by the New Hanover County Board of Commissioners in entering into and in connection with contracts for the construction of a refuse fired steam generating facility for New Hanover County, including construction and installation of an incinerator and related appurtenances and installation of equipment and machinery required therefor, are hereby ratified and validated.  Provided, however, that the engineer whose name and seal appear on plans and specifications shall inspect the construction and installation and shall issue a signed and sealed certificate of compliance with said plans and specifications as provided by Chapter 133 of the General Statutes.

Sec. 2.  This act shall apply only to New Hanover County.

Sec. 3.  This act shall become effective upon ratification.

In the General Assembly read three times and ratified, this the 23rd day of May, 1983.
